一、简单说明 1.打开数据库 int sqlite3_open( const char *filename, // 数据库的文件路径 sqlite3 **ppDb // 数据库实例 ); 2.执行任何SQL语句 int sqlite3_exec( sqlite
iOS开发数据库篇—SQLite常用的函数 一、简单说明 1.打开数据库 int sqlite3_open( const char *filename, // 数据库的文件路径 sqlite3 **ppDb // 数据库实
1 打开数据库文件 sqlite3* m_db = NULL; int ret = sqlite3_open_v2("test.db", &db, SQLITE_OPEN_READWRITE, NULL); if (ret != SQLITE_OK) { re
终于效果图: Sqlite3函数总结 1.打开数据库 int sqlite3_open( const char *filename, // 数据库的文件路径 sqlite3 **ppDb // 数据库实例 ); 2.运行不论什么SQL语句 int sqlit
首先,添加framework:libsqlite3.0.dylib 需要在对应文件的头文件中加入: #import "/usr/include/sqlite3.h" 并在Frameworks中加入所需的库,否则会报错: Undefined symbols: "
前序: Sqlite3 的确很好用。小巧、速度快。但是因为非微软的产品,帮助文档总觉得不够。这些天再次研究它,又有一些收获,这里把我对 sqlite3 的研究列出来,以备忘记。 这里要注明,我是一个跨平台专注者,并不喜欢只用 windows 平台。我以前的工作
1. Sqlite3数据类型及存储类 每个存放在sqlite数据库中(或者由这个数据库引擎操作)的值都有下面中的一个存储类: (1)NULL,值是NULL (2)INTEGER,值是有符号整形,根据值的大小以1,2,3,4,6或8字节存放 (3)REAL,值是
SQLite支持的常见数据类型如下所示。 –INTEGER 有符号的整数类型 –REAL 浮点类型 –TEXT 字符串类型,采用UTF-8和UTF-16字符编码 –BLOB 二进制大对象类型,能够存放任何二进制数据 (C语言中)使用步骤: 1.新建项目时,先
我需要一个简单的createDB函数,如果DB文件不错字,就创建生成,但是在创建文件时报出 No Such file or directory 错误。 下面是代码中的一段: ``` -(void) createDB { NSStrin
db.execSQL("create table t_user (_id integer primary key autoincrement,phone,starttime,expiretime)"); 将expiretime赋值为String类型的1461
单独更新imagepath字段语句执行没有效果。imagepath和description一起更新就有效果,为什么? 代码: String sql = "update t_pattern set name = ? ,userid = ?,descripti
我在之后使用数据库时,发现只有前三个字段,INTRODUCT及以后的都没有,请问这是为什么 private static final String DATABASE_CREATE = "create table classname
我在之后使用数据库时,发现只有前三个字段,INTRODUCT及以后的都没有,请问这是为什么 ``` private static final String DATABASE_CREATE = "create table clas
``` 想要在表单中新加入一行然后确认是否加入正确,等到查询的时候,程序就崩溃了。 addNewGame(1); Cursor cursor2 = db.query(myDBOpenHelper.GAMES_TABLE, new String []
我有这样的一个需求:整个项目的模块是分别在多个独立的lib工程中,通过挂载整合成一个完整的项目,我希望整个项目只有一个DB,可是我在不同模块(也就是不同lib工程中)分别写了各自的DBHelper(都继承SQLiteOpenHelper),并且在DBHelpe
路过的大神,求帮忙解答下,小弟学习安卓SQLite时,遇到了如下错误 ![screenshot](https://oss-cn-hangzhou.aliyuncs.com/yqfiles/cec6d94f4075fde62a4b99d60ad4029abb5